What Supermicro SuperStorage® Servers Offer

1. Broad, Flexible Storage Options

SuperStorage® servers come in 1U to 4U configurations, including all-flash NVMe, hybrid, and high-density HDD systems with front- or top-loading designs. This flexibility allows organizations to optimize for performance, capacity, or both.

2. High-Performance Architecture

Powered by the latest Intel Xeon and AMD EPYC processors, these systems offer high core counts, large memory capacity, and optimized PCIe lanes for NVMe. The result is balanced CPU and I/O performance for AI, analytics, virtualization, and cloud workloads.

3. Advanced Storage Media Support

SuperStorage® supports NVMe (U.2, E1.S, E3.S), SATA/SAS SSDs, and high-capacity HDDs. Rapid validation with leading drive vendors ensures readiness for emerging storage technologies.

4. Software-Defined Storage Ready

Designed for VMware vSAN, Microsoft Azure Stack HCI, and other SDS platforms, SuperStorage® systems provide a validated, optimized hardware foundation for scalable software-defined environments.

5. Enterprise-Grade Reliability

With hot-swappable drives, redundant power supplies and cooling, and tool-less maintenance, these servers ensure high availability and simplified servicing for 24/7 operations.

6. Rack-Level Integration

Supermicro delivers integrated rack solutions combining compute, storage, networking, and management — reducing deployment time and simplifying large-scale rollouts.
